    Most genius favors? Our colors were teal and purple. I wanted to add those colors on our table by using our favors, so I chose to go with M&Ms (who doesn't love them!). Since we were on a budget (and MMs.com is super expensive), I stopped at Michaels everyday after work and got them one bag at a time with a 40% or 50% coupon! I placed the two colors together, mixed them around and placed them in a clear box with a silver ribbon (also at michaels with 50% off coupon).  The end result was exactly what we wanted and we got many compliments! Super simple and budget friendly too.
